[0001] This utility model relates to the field of material conveying technology, and in particular to a pneumatic conveying system for viscous materials. Background Technology
[0002] In the chemical, food, and pharmaceutical industries, pipeline transportation of viscous materials is a core production process, and its efficiency and airtightness directly affect product quality and energy consumption. Currently, centrifugal pumps or screw pumps are the mainstream methods for transportation. These mechanical pumps rely on impeller rotation to propel materials, which has certain shortcomings: Traditional pumping systems often suffer from serious odor loss and energy waste due to material residue in the conveying of viscous materials, which are volatile and emit odors. Existing viscous material conveying technologies lack viscosity adaptive mechanisms, resulting in unstable conveying efficiency. Meanwhile, the liquid level monitoring of storage units relies on a single sensor, making it difficult to eliminate the risk of overflow. Pipeline sedimentation exacerbates the equipment maintenance burden. Therefore, it is necessary to design a pneumatic conveying system for viscous materials. Utility Model Content

[0017] Please see the appendix Figure 1 An embodiment of this utility model is provided: a pneumatic conveying system for viscous materials, including a reaction vessel 1 and a storage tank 2. The bottom of the reaction vessel 1 is provided with a discharge port, and the storage tank 2 is connected to the discharge port of the reaction vessel 1 through a first connecting pipe 11. A transparent observation window is embedded in the top of the storage tank 2. The bottom outlet of storage tank 2 is connected to the downstream process via the second connecting pipe 21; The first connecting pipe 11 and the second connecting pipe 21 are respectively equipped with a first pneumatic shut-off valve 111 and a second pneumatic shut-off valve 211, and the connection of each pipe has good sealing performance. The top of the storage tank 2 is connected to the pneumatic compressor unit 3 via a third connecting pipe 22. A proportional regulating valve 221 is installed on the third connecting pipe 22, and the valve core opening of the proportional regulating valve 221 is controlled by the PLC controller 5. The pneumatic compressor unit 3 includes a positive pressure compressor and a negative pressure vacuum pump connected in parallel. The start and stop of the positive pressure compressor and the negative pressure vacuum pump are independently controlled by the PLC controller 5. The pneumatic compressor unit 3 has dual working modes of positive pressure boosting and negative pressure evacuation. The pneumatic compressor unit 3 has a built-in air path switching mechanism, which realizes rapid switching between positive and negative pressure modes through a solenoid valve. A stable vacuum environment is formed during negative pressure evacuation, and a stable vacuum environment is established during positive pressure boosting. A continuous and controllable pressure field; a limit alarm 6 is installed on the top of the storage tank 2 to detect the liquid level of the material in the tank. The limit alarm 6 is connected to the PLC controller 5. When the liquid level reaches the upper limit, it triggers the closure of the first pneumatic shut-off valve 111 and alarms; the dual working modes of the pneumatic compressor unit 3 are: negative pressure suction mode: start the negative pressure pump to form a negative pressure in the storage tank 2, and at the same time open the first pneumatic shut-off valve 111 to suck in the material in the reactor 1; positive pressure conveying mode: close the first pneumatic shut-off valve 111, switch to positive pressure boosting and open the second pneumatic shut-off valve 211 to press the material into the second connecting pipe 21; A viscometer 4 is installed on the top of the reactor 1, with its probe extending to the bottom of the reactor 1. The sensor detects the resistance to material flow in real time, ensuring the accuracy of viscosity monitoring at all liquid levels. Viscometer 4, air compressor unit 3, first pneumatic shut-off valve 111 and second pneumatic shut-off valve 211 are all connected to PLC controller 5. PLC controller 5 integrates a signal conversion module to convert the analog signal of viscometer 4 into air pressure control command, and stabilizes the output air pressure intensity through PID algorithm to avoid uneven delivery caused by pressure fluctuation. PLC controller 5 is configured to adjust the output air pressure of air compressor unit 3 according to the real-time viscosity data of viscometer 4.
[0018] Specifically, in use, the first stage is negative pressure material suction: PLC controller 5 starts the negative pressure vacuum pump of pneumatic compressor unit 3, and evacuates air from storage tank 2 through the third connecting pipe 22 to create a negative pressure environment inside the tank; PLC controller 5 opens the first pneumatic shut-off valve 111, and the material in reactor 1 is drawn into storage tank 2 through the first connecting pipe 11 under the action of pressure difference; limit alarm 6 monitors the liquid level of storage tank 2 in real time, and when the upper limit is reached, it triggers PLC controller 5 to close the first pneumatic shut-off valve 111 and alarm; Positive pressure conveying stage: PLC controller 5 switches pneumatic compressor unit 3 to positive pressure compressor, and at the same time closes the first pneumatic shut-off valve 111; PLC controller 5 opens the second pneumatic shut-off valve 211 to pressurize the storage tank 2, and the material is pressed into the downstream process through the second connecting pipe 21; the proportional regulating valve 221 adjusts the opening degree according to the data of viscometer 4: if the viscosity increases, the opening degree is increased, and the pressure after the valve is increased; if the viscosity decreases, the opening degree is decreased, and the pressure after the valve is decreased; a dynamic air pressure gradient is formed in the pipeline; Viscosity adaptive adjustment: Viscometer 4 probe detects the viscosity of the material at the bottom of reactor 1 in real time and transmits the data to PLC controller 5; PLC controller 5 synchronously adjusts the output air pressure intensity of air compressor unit 3 and the valve core opening of proportional regulating valve 221 to achieve real-time matching between conveying pressure and viscosity; System inspection and maintenance: Manually check the residual material in storage tank 2 through the transparent observation window, start the pneumatic compressor unit 3 in strong positive pressure mode; fully open the proportional regulating valve 221, and the high-pressure airflow flushes the first connecting pipe 11 and the second connecting pipe 21 to remove the deposits on the pipe walls; In summary, this utility model achieves fully enclosed conveying through the dual-mode switching of the pneumatic compressor unit, completely eliminating the odor emission caused by material volatilization; the negative pressure suction mode ensures no material residue transfer, eliminating energy waste; and the positive pressure conveying combined with the proportional regulating valve 221 significantly improves conveying efficiency. The system features real-time viscosity monitoring and automatic pressure adjustment, enabling it to adapt to viscosity variations of different materials. Limit alarms and transparent observation windows form a dual liquid level monitoring mechanism, effectively preventing the risk of spillage. Dynamic pressure gradient control significantly reduces pipeline sedimentation and extends equipment maintenance cycles.
